CUPS without HAL

My Canon PIXMA MP150 won't print after I uninstalled hal. It return error: File "/usr/libs/cups/backend/hal" not available: No such file or directory. Is it possible to make cups work without hal?

Re: CUPS without HAL

CUPS doesn't need HAL and hasn't for some time - in fact I don't think HAL even exists in the repos any more (I haven't had it on my system for ages).
What version of CUPS are you using?

Re: CUPS without HAL

You might just need to reinstall the printer.
This package provides a driver for your printer, if you don't have it already: https://www.archlinux.org/packages/extr … utenprint/
